Objective

Upon completion of the course, students are aware of the special nature of old age as a stage of life and make meaningful daily life possible for the aged. They are able to explain and compare changes in aged people's functional capacity and coping in daily life a based on the gerontological knowledge. They are able to be in interaction with the aged. The profession of the work with the aged begins to take shape to the student.

Content

Practical training in a setting which enables meaningful daily life for older people. Practical placement in selected by the student.
